Federal Tax Forms

  •  

    Everett Public Schools issues employees the following federal payroll tax forms:  Form W-2 Wage and Tax Statement, Form 1095-C Employer-Provided Health Insurance Offer and Coverage

    All federal tax forms will be posted to the district's employee online portal no later than the required deadline posted by the IRS for each form. Deadlines for the current tax year can be found on www.irs.gov.

    Instructions for accessing your form are as follows:

    For actively-employed staff (substitutes, coaches, games workers, etc.) - forms may be accessed through Employee Online. If you did not elect to receive your W-2 form electronically, the W-2 form will additionally be mailed to the address on file with Human Resources. If you were covered with health insurance through Everett Public School benefits at any time in the most recent completed tax year, your 1095-C form will be posted electronically only - it will not be mailed. After the required posting date determined annually by the IRS, if you would like a paper copy of your 1095-C form, you may request a paper copy by sending a request to payroll@everettsd.org. Requests will be completed within 30 days of receipt of the request. The 1095-C form is not required for individual income tax filing.

    For former staff (separated from employment in the previous tax year) or former employees and/or their dependents covered by PEBB - the W-2 Form will be mailed to the address on file with Human Resources. If you were covered with health insurance through Everett Public School benefits at any time in the most recent completed tax year, or through the Health Care Authority PEBB insurance program, your 1095-C form will be posted electronically only - it will not be mailed. After the required posting date determined annually by the IRS, if you would like a paper copy of your 1095-C form, you may request a paper copy by sending a request to payroll@everettsd.org. Requests will be completed within 30 days of receipt of the request. Please be prepared to authenticate your identity with any requests for these forms. The 1095-C form is not required for individual income tax filing.
